Scientific theory can be explained as a theory that was highly supported by facts. This means that , it is continuously or repeatedly confirmed by observation and experiment by scientists.
Evolution can be described as changes that occur in the heritable characters over a period of time. This usually occurs through natural selection.
In this case, evolution is known to be a scientific theory, because it involved careful observations and confirming experiments by scientists.

A naturalist visiting an island in the middle of a large lake observes a species of small bird with three distinct types of beaks. Those with short, crushing beaks (BB) consume hard shelled nuts, those with long, delicate beaks (bb) pick the seeds from pine cones, and those with intermediate beaks (Bb), consume both types of seeds though they are not as good at either. Assume that this difference in beak morphology is the result of incomplete dominance in a single locus gene. Which of the mated pairs below will have the best adapted offspring in a year in which most of the food available is in the form of hard shelled nuts? What would be the phenotypic ratio of the F1 generation resulting from a cross of Bb x bb(Short:Intermediate:Long)? How many offspring of an intermediate x short beak cross will have long beaks (assume 4)?
A) since the feed is put into consideration, then the offspring that is best adapted to feed on hard shelled but is to be considered. Cross-linking a gene BB with Bb is the best. If BB is said to be dominant then the offspring are produced will be short beak and intermediate beak in the ratio of 2:2 where both are suitable for feeding on hard shelled but.
B) The phenotypic ratio of the F1 generation (first generation or offspring) between Bb and bb is that there won't be a pure short beak(BB). Therefore 0:2:2 for short: intermediate: long.
C) for the intermediate and short beak crosslinking there won't be a long beak in the first generation when we limit the number offspring to four.

<h3>What do you mean by Mutation?</h3>
A Mutation may be defined as sudden, stable, and inheritable changes in the genetic material of an organism.
Gametes of germline cells play an important role in the inheritance of mutation from parents to their offspring, which means that if a mutation has occurred in an egg or sperm cell, it will be more chances that the offspring carry mutated DNA.

Protozoa are single-celled eukaryotic organisms. Many aquatic animals feed on protozoa. Protozoa help control the population of bacteria as well as other protozoans by feeding on them. Controlling the population of other organisms is important in maintaining ecological balance and diversity.
